2 MISSIONS TODAY

2 MISSIONS TODAY

The Palmerston North Rescue Helicopter was dispatched to Levin this morning at around 3:00am for a 5 year old with a medical emergency. She was stabilised by St John paramedics before being airlifted, along with her Mum, to Wellington Hospital for specialist treatment. The mission was flown with the aid of Night Vision Goggles. Later this afternoon at around 2:30pm the helicopter was dispatched to Te Horo for a man in his 50’s, injured after he was hit by a steer. He was stabilised by St John paramedics before being airlifted to Palmerston North Hospital.


Philips Search and Rescue Trust (PSRT) is a charitable organisation, operating rescue helicopters throughout the Central North Island. Philips Search and Rescue Trust relies on support from principal sponsors and community donations. This crucial financial support ensures our rescue helicopters can continue to bring life-saving equipment, rescue personnel and trauma-trained medics directly to the patient.
